ELISPOT Assay for Antibody-Secreting Cells

Check if the same lab product or an alternative is used in the 5 most similar protocols
Antibody-secreting cells were measured in peripheral blood according to our previously described enzyme-linked immunosorbent spot (ELISPOT) procedure (26 (link), 37 (link)). Briefly, nitrocellulose (bottom) plates (MSHAN-4550; Millipore, Bedford, MA) were coated with 100 μl of sialidase (25 μg/ml) in sodium bicarbonate buffer (pH 9.6), affinity-purified goat anti-human immunoglobulin (5 μg/ml; Jackson Immuno Research, West Grove, PA) to detect the total number of circulating ASCs, or keyhole limpet hemocyanin (KLH; 2.5 μg/ml [Pierce Biotechnology, Rockford, IL]) in PBS as a negative control. After blocking with RPMI solution, isolated PBMCs were incubated on the plates for 3 h, and secreted antibodies were detected with peroxidase-conjugated mouse anti-human IgA (1:500 dilution; Southern Biotech, Birmingham, AL) and alkaline phosphatase-conjugated IgG (1:500 dilution; Southern Biotech, Birmingham, AL). ASCs were detected with 3-amino-9-ethylcarbazole (AEC) (AEC premix solution; Sigma-Aldrich) and 5-bromo-4-chloro-3-indolylphosphate–nitroblue tetrazolium (BCIP/NBT; Sigma-Aldrich). The antigen-specific IgA and IgG isotypes of ASCs were expressed as the frequencies of the total circulating ASCs of the same isotype at the same time point.

ELISPOT Assay for Antigen-Specific ASCs

Check if the same lab product or an alternative is used in the 5 most similar protocols
ASC responses were assessed through ELISPOT technique as described previously (35 (link)). Affinity-purified goat anti-human immunoglobulin (Jackson ImmunoResearch) as a positive control, V. cholerae O1 Ogawa OSP: BSA (10 µg/mL), GM1 ganglioside (3 nmol/mL) followed by recombinant CtxB (2.5 µg/mL), and as a negative control, keyhole limpet hemocyanin (KLH, 2.5 µg/mL; Pierce Biotechnology, Rockford, IL, USA) were used as coating antigen to coat nitrocellulose-bottom plates (Millipore, Bedford, MA, USA). Goat anti-human IgG (Southern Biotech, Birmingham, AL, USA) conjugated with alkaline phosphatase was used to detect IgG ASCs, and to detect IgA ASCs, horseradish peroxidase-conjugated goat anti-human IgA (Southern Biotech) was added to the plates, respectively. Plates were incubated overnight at 4°C, and on the following day, plates were developed using 5-bromo-4-chloro-3-indolylphosphate-nitroblue tetrazolium (Sigma-Aldrich) and 3-amino-9-ethylcarbazole (pre-mix solution, Sigma-Aldrich) as substrate, respectively.
